Contraviro Description:

Contraviro is not one of the trustworthy programs because it uses illicit tactics to propagate and get people paying for its license. Contraviro hails from the same family of fake anti-spyware programs as UnVirex and inherits most of its characteristic traits. For example, the methods of hidden installation onto a host node are common – they presuppose the use of Trojans that sneak inside though firewall flaws and other security vulnerabilities of the challenged system. Upon infiltration, Contraviro makes the system launch its unregistered trialware each time the PC starts, which basically means you will keep getting more and more of its scanners and phony alerts about malware detections on your PC. Indeed, Contraviro pretends to scan the compromised computer and then produces fake detection reports that list a variety of threats that are nor removable unless you register Contraviro full commercial version. It’s important to realize that Contraviro never detects any actual malware simply because it’s not a real security product. Therefore, it’s totally unacceptable to follow the recommendations prompted via Contraviro alerts that pop up to tell you how much you need its full version. How to remove Contraviro manually:

To perform manual removal of Contraviro, you should do the following:

Delete Contraviro corrupt files:

  • %Program Files%\Contraviro
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\Contraviro.exe
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\daily.cvd
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\Drvfltip.sys
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\hjengine.dll
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\IEAddon.dll
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\main.cvd
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\MFC71.dll
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\MFC71ENU.DLL
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\msvcp71.dll
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\msvcr71.dll
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\pthreadVC2.dll
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\shellext.dll
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\siglsp.dll
  • %Program Files%\Contraviro\uninstall.exe
  • %Documents and Settings%\All Users\Start Menu\Programs\Contraviro
  • %Documents and Settings%\All Users\Desktop\Contraviro.lnk
  • %Documents and Settings%\All Users\Start Menu\Programs\Contraviro.lnk
  • %Documents and Settings%\All Users\Start Menu\Programs\Contraviro\Contraviro.lnk
  • %Documents and Settings%\All Users\Start Menu\Programs\Contraviro\How to Register Contraviro.lnk
  • %Documents and Settings%\All Users\Start Menu\Programs\Contraviro\Register Contraviro.lnk
  • %UserProfile%\Application Data\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Quick Launch\Contraviro.lnk

Remove Contraviro associated registry entries:

  • H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\*\shellex\ContextMenuHandlers\antivirus_contextscan
  • H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\AppID\{C0E56AC2-9F72-436E-B6E7-AEC28AF9E4EB}
  • H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\AppID\IEAddon.DLL
  • H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{08EEC6AD-7486-487F-89B7-5A3716DDAE14}
  • H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{CCB5551D-8594-4999-85F9-1E3EABCB95AC}
  • H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\Drive\shellex\ContextMenuHandlers\antivirus_contextscan
  • H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\Drives\shellex\ContextMenuHandlers\antivirus_contextscan
  • H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\Folder\shellex\ContextMenuHandlers\antivirus_contextscan
  • H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\Interface\{5B184B9D-B7BD-4FEA-8D1F-5E27182206A5}
  • H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\TypeLib\{3ED0E410-5C8E-47B6-A75D-D10B886E903C}
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Contraviro
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explorer\Browser Helper Objects\{CCB5551D-8594-4999-85F9-1E3EABCB95AC}
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Uninstall\Contraviro
  • H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Winlogon “Shell”
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Internet Settings\User Agent\Post Platform “Contraviro”
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run “Contraviro”
